Ingredients You’ll Need
- 32 Golden Oreos (not separated): These are the star of the crust, providing a sweet, creamy base with a satisfying crunch. You can substitute with any sandwich cookie for a different flavor.
- 5 Tbsp unsalted butter (melted): Butter binds the crushed Oreos together to create a sturdy crust. Be sure to use unsalted to control the saltiness.
- 1 Tbsp sugar: Just a touch of sugar enhances the sweetness of the crust.
- ½ tsp vanilla extract: This adds a warm note that complements the other flavors, making the crust even more delightful.
- Pinch of sea salt (optional): A small amount balances the sweetness but can be omitted if you prefer.
- 3 blocks cream cheese (8 oz. each) (softened): Cream cheese gives the cheesecake its rich and creamy texture. Make sure it’s softened for smooth mixing.
- ½ cup sugar: Sweetens the cheesecake filling. Adjust to taste if desired!
- 1½ tsp vanilla extract: Enhances the overall flavor profile of the cheesecake.
- ½ tsp almond extract: This adds a lovely, subtle nutty flavor that brings the cake batter essence to life. You can also use a splash of cake batter extract for a fun twist.
- ⅓ cup confectioner’s sugar: This powdered form of sugar dissolves easily, creating a silky filling.
- ½ cup sour cream (room temperature): Sour cream contributes to the creamy texture and slightly tangy flavor that balances the sweetness.
- 1 cup heavy whipping cream (COLD): Whipped cream folded into the filling gives it a light and airy texture. Make sure it’s chilled for the best results.
- ½ – ⅔ cup rainbow sprinkles: These add color and fun; use “jimmies” for the best texture. Feel free to add more on top when serving!
- Whipped cream and sprinkles to pipe and decorate edges for serving: A whimsical touch to the finished cake that heightens its visual appeal.
How to Make No-Bake Funfetti Cheesecake
Prepare the Crust: Start by crushing the 32 Golden Oreos until they resemble fine crumbs. You can use a food processor or place them in a zip-top bag and crush with a rolling pin. Mix in the melted butter, 1 Tbsp of sugar, and ½ tsp vanilla extract until combined. If you like, add a pinch of sea salt for balance. Press this mixture into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an evenly. Refrigerate while you prepare the filling.
Mix the Cheesecake Filling: In a large mixing bowl, add the softened cream cheese (3 blocks) and ½ cup of sugar. Beat with an electric mixer on low speed until combined and smooth—this should take about 2-3 minutes. Now add in the 1½ tsp vanilla extract, ½ tsp almond extract, and ⅓ cup confectioners sugar, continuing to mix until everything is well incorporated. Then, gently fold in the room temperature sour cream and stir until smooth.
Whip the Cream: In a separate bowl, pour the 1 cup of cold heavy whipping cream. Using the electric mixer, beat on medium-high speed until stiff peaks form, which will take around 3-5 minutes.
Combine Everything: Carefully fold the whipped cream into the cheesecake mixture in three parts, ensuring you maintain as much air as possible for a light texture. Once fully combined, gently fold in ½ – ⅔ cup of rainbow sprinkles.
Assemble the Cheesecake: Pour the cheesecake filling into the prepared crust, spreading it evenly with a spatula. Add more sprinkles on top for a festive look!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or ideally overnight, to allow it to set beautifully.
Serve: When you’re ready to indulge, carefully remove the sides of the springform pan. Pipe some whipped cream around the edges and sprinkle additional sprinkles on top for that extra pop. Slice, serve, and watch everyone enjoy your delectable creation!
Storing & Reheating
To store your No-Bake Funfetti Cheesecake, keep it covered in the fridge for up to 5 days—this ensures it stays fresh and creamy. You can also freeze it for up to three months; simply slice it in individual pieces and wrap each in plastic wrap before placing it in an airtight container. To refresh after thawing, let it sit in the fridge a few hours before serving again for the best texture and flavor!
Chef’s Helpful Tips
- Don’t Rush the Cream Cheese: Make sure your cream cheese is softened to room temperature to avoid lumps and achieve a smooth filling.
- Whip Cream Carefully: Be cautious when folding in the whipped cream; overmixing can deflate your filling, diminishing the airy and light texture.
- Chill Time is Key: The longer you chill the cheesecake, the better it will set, enhancing its flavors and textures.

Recipe FAQs
Can I make the cheesecake in advance?
Yes! It’s perfect for making ahead of time. Preparing it the day before is even better to allow the flavors to meld and achieve a firmer set.
How can I make this cheesecake gluten-free?
To make a gluten-free version, simply substitute the Golden Oreos with gluten-free sandwich cookies, and ensure all other ingredients are certified gluten-free.
Can I use a different crust?
Absolutely! While the Golden Oreo crust is a favorite, you can use any cookie-based crust or even a graham cracker crust, depending on your preference.
What should I do if my cheesecake doesn’t set?
If your cheesecake hasn’t set after chilling, it may need more time in the refrigerator. Allow it to chill longer, and consider checking the balance of cream cheese to whipping cream ratio for better results next time!
